[0001] The present invention relates to a fitting assembly for pivotal connection of a sash
component with respect to a main frame component of an openable window structure,
comprising elongate first and second fitting members for connection with opposed side
members of the main frame and sash components, respectively, said second fitting member
being pivotally connected at a first end with a slide member fitted in said first
member for sliding motion through part of the length of the first fitting member from
a first end thereof, and a stay member having a first end pivotally connected with
the first fitting member adjacent a second end thereof and a second end pivotally
connected with the second fitting member at a distance from the second end thereof
to allow pivotal movement of the sash component between a closed position of the sash
component, in which the first and second fitting members and the stay member extend
in overlying substantially parallel relationship and any position within a range of
opening positions defined by the pivotal connections of the fitting and stay members.
[0002] Fitting assemblies of this kind are commonly used for assembling the sash and main
frame components of top-hung openable window structures.
[0003] In such assembling operations, by which the first and second fitting members are
connected with opposed side member of the sash and main components at one vertical
side thereof, difficulties are occasionally encountered in obtaining a desired accurate
positioning of the sash component within the opening provided by the main frame component
due to tolerances in the production of the window components and/or distortions imparted
to the main frame component during its installation in a window opening in a building
wall. By distortion of the positioning of the sash component the side, top and bottom
members thereof may become out of alignment with the opposed side, bottom and top
members of the main frame component and, at worst, it may become impossible to fit
the sash component correctly within the main frame component.
[0004] It is the object of the invention to provide a simple and user friendly adjusting
mechanism to eliminate this problem.
[0005] According to the invention this object is accomplished by a fitting assembly of the
kind defined, which is characterized in that adjusting means is provided at the second
end of the first fitting member for adjustment of the position of the pivotal connection
of the first end of the stay member with the first fitting member.
[0006] Thereby, an out of alignment distortion between the sash compent and the main frame
component may in most cases be easily remedied by adjustment of the adjustment means
of the fitting assembly at one and/or the other vertical side of the sash and main
frame components. By this adjustment the position of the pivotal connection of the
first end of the stay member with the first fitting member may be sufficiently adjusted
to restore a correctly aligned mounting of the sash component with respect to the
main frame component.

[0013] As shown in the drawing the adjustable fitting assembly according to the invention
comprises a first fitting member 1 for connection the inner side of a vertical side
member of the main frame component of a top-hung window structure and a second fitting
member 2, which is adapted for connection with the sash component of the window.
[0014] At a first end, the second fitting member 2 is provided with a pivot member 3 for
pivotal connection with a slide member 4 fitted in the first fitting member 1 at a
first end thereof for sliding motion through a part of the length of the first fitting
member 1.
[0015] Between the first and second fitting members 1 and 2 a stay member 5 is provided,
which is pivotally connected at a first end by pivot means 6 with adjusting means
generally designated by 7, which is provided at the second end of the first fitting
member 1 and will be further explained in the following.
[0016] At its second end the stay member 5 is provided with pivot means 8 for pivotal connection
with the second fitting member 2 at a distance from a second end thereof.
[0017] As more clearly illustrated in fig. 2, the adjusting means 7 comprises a first adjusting
member 9, which is adjustably fitted in the first fitting member 1 adjacent the second
end thereof and is provided with the pivot member 6, with which the first end of the
stay member 5 is pivotally connected, and a second adjusting member 10, which is fixed
with the second end of the first fitting member 1 and provides adjustable contact
means adapted for contact by an end contact part 11 of the first adjusting member
9.
[0018] The end contact part 11 is formed by a first end section 9a of the first adjusting
member 9, which includes the pivot member 6 for pivotal connection of the first adjusting
member 9 with the first end of the stay member 5. The first adjusting member 9 comprises
also a second end section 9b, which is offset from the first end section 9a by a shoulder
portion 9c, and by means of which the first adjusting member 9 may be firmly secured
with respect to the first fitting member 1, once the first adjusting member 9 has
been adjusted into a correct position with respect to the first fitting member 1.
[0019] Adjustment of the first adjusting member 9 into a desired adjusted position of the
pivot means 6 is accomplished by means of the second adjusting member 10, which comprises
a brick-like member 12 providing a blind receptacle with an entrance opening in one
end face 13 of the brick-like member for receiving the end contact part 11 of the
first adjusting member 9.
[0020] At the bottom of the blind receptacle in the second adjusting member 10 contact means
for the end contact part 11 of the first adjusting member 9 is provided by an adjustable
contact member, preferably in the form of an adjusting screw 14 screwed into the blind
receptacle from the opposite end face 15 of the brick-like member 12.
[0021] In the illustrated embodiment the fitting assembly according to the invention is
designed mainly for use with window structures having main frame and sash components
made up of wood profiles and the first and second fitting members 1 and 2 and the
first and second adjusting members 9 and 11 is provided with holes for conventional
screw connections. Specifically, to accomplish a desired range for adjustment of the
position of the pivot member 6 with respect to the first fitting member 1 an elongate
screw hole 16 is formed in the second offset end section 9b of the first adjusting
member 9.
[0022] By offsetting the first end section 9a of the first adjusting member 9 from the second
end section by means of the shoulder portion 9c the pivotal mo-vability of the stay
member 5 with respect to the first fitting member 1 by the pivot member 6 is secured.
[0023] In use of the fitting assembly the second fitting member 2 is first connected with
a vertical side member of the sash component of the window structure, which at this
stage is separated from the main frame component. To secure correct positioning at
the end of the sash side member joined with the top member of the sash component the
second fitting member 2 may be formed with a projecting angular arm 17, which may
be connected with the sash top member close to its corner junction with the side member.
[0024] The first fitting member 1 may now be connected with the vertical side member of
the main frame component intended to be opposed to the sash side member, with which
the second fitting member 2 is connected, the first fitting member 1 being positioned
at the main frame side member to have its upper end 18 placed in contact with the
top member of the main frame component.
[0025] If a distortion or misalignment of the sash component with respect to the main frame
component is observed, correction may be accomplished by the adjusting mechanism provided
by the invention, by which the position of the pivot member 6, by which the stay member
5 is pivotally connected via the first adjusting member 9 with the first fitting member
1, is adjusted. The adjustment is made by means of the adjusting screw 14 acting on
the end contact part 11 of the first adjusting member 9, whereby the position of the
first adjusting member 9 may be displaced within the range provided by the elongate
screw hole 16, through which the thus adjusted position of the first adjusting member
9 with respect to the first fitting member 1 may be secured. Typically the displacement
range thus provided for adjustment will be a few millimetres.
